Opening Doors to Music: A Conversation with Two Composers

We've all seen beautiful paintings and photographs of doors; far less common is music inspired by them. NMSU tuba professor Dr. Jim Shearer asked his colleague, Lon Chaffin (Music Department Chair) to write a work inspired by doors -- and using photographs taken by Albuquerque artist Jim Gale, Chaffin incorporated the images into a multi-media composition. Shearer also commissioned Arkansas-based composer Lester Pack and NMSU alumnus Justin Raines to compose new works. The result: three world premieres for the rather unusual combination of tuba (performed by Jim Shearer) and string quartet (La Catrina Quartet). Chaffin and Pack came to KRWG to discuss the writing of the pieces, their approaches to composition and more, in this interview with Leora Zeitlin, host of Intermezzo.
